Trent Voss is in his second season on the coaching staff at Youngstown State in 2025. He serves as YSU's safeties coach.

In 2024, the unit showed improvement throughout the campaign. DJ Harris (57) and Makai Shahid (56) ranked one and two on the squad in tackles while Stephon Hall (51) was fifth. Harris was named to the MVFC All-Newcomer Team as he saw increased playing time later in the season. In total, three safeties tied for the team lead in interceptions.

Voss joined the YSU coaching staff in February 2024 after spending three campaigns at Ohio Dominican.

In 2023, ODU had an impressive seven defensive players earn All-Great Midwest Athletic Conference honors. The Panthers held opponents to fewer than 20 points per game while limiting teams under 100 yards a game on the ground. G-MAC Co-Player of the Year Eddie Miller-Garrett earned All-America honors and was a nominee for the Harlon Hill Trophy.

Miller-Garrett made 60 tackles (4th on the team), 23.0 tackles for loss, 10.5 sacks, two forced fumbles, one fumble recovery and 17 QB hurries. He led the G-MAC with TFL and sacks (7.5 TFL ahead of 2nd and 2.0 sacks ahead of 2nd) and finished as the ODU single-season leader for tackles for loss and sacks.

In 2022, the unit surrendered only 16.9 points per game allowing just 22 touchdowns in 10 games. The defense had 15 interceptions and held opposing offenses to just a 33 percent conversion rate on third down.

Jaylin Garner was named the G-MAC Defensive Player of the Year as the Panthers had five first-team all-league selections. Three other members of the defense earned second-team all-conference laurels.

In 2021, Voss led one of the top scoring defense's in the Great Midwest, ranking second with an average of 20.9 points per game. The Panthers' mark also ranked among the top 35 nationally. Ohio Dominican was also top three in the conference in total defense, conceding 336.5 yards per game. ODU also enjoyed a 31-0 shutout win over Lake Erie, a game the defense set a new program sack record with 11. Eddie Miller-Garrett broke the single game individual sack record as well with 3.5. 

Nine Panther defenders received all-GMAC awards in 2021, including three first team selections. Senior linebacker Dauson Dales became the first defensive player in G-MAC history to be named the Overall Player of the Year, and added two all-American honors. Under Voss' guidance, Dales broke the single season (122) and career (376) tackle records for ODU in 2021. 

Previously he worked at John Carroll University (2020-21) where he was the Defensive Run Game Coordinator, Recruiting Coordinator and Defensive Line Coach.

As a Graduate Assistant at Toledo, Voss assisted in coaching Linebackers and Safeties and helped lead the University of Toledo to the 2017 MAC Championship. He also aided the Rockets as a Defensive Quality Control Analyst and advisor to their defensive coordinator.

Other positions Voss has held include Linebackers and Strength and Conditioning Coach at North Point High School.

Voss is a graduate of Toledo where he received both his undergraduate, B.A. degree in Business Management and Master’s in Recreation Administration. As a three-year starter on the Rockets football team, helped lead them to three bowl games and was an all-conference selection in 2015.

Voss and his wife, Alexis, have two sons -- Cayden and Jett.
